Praise the Lord, all you nations; extol him, all you peoples. For great is his love toward us and the faithfulness of the Lord endures forever. Praise the Lord.—Psalm 117:1-2 NIV
There are 1,189 chapters in the Bible and the shortest chapter is Psalm 117, shown above in its entirety. This tiny chapter falls numerically right in the middle of the Bible, which is appropriate as its message is at the heart of God’s Word. Praise the Lord for His love endures now and forever.
